Ulaangom vs Passo Fundo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Ulaangom, Mongolia and Passo Fundo, Brazil is approximately 16,181 km or 10,055 mi.
  • To reach Ulaangom in this distance one would set out from Passo Fundo bearing 41.5°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Ulaangom bearing 115.3° or ESE .
  • Ulaangom has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k) whereas Passo Fundo has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Ulaangom is in or near the boreal wet forest biome whereas Passo Fundo is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 21 °C (37.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 41.6 °C (74.9°F) more in Ulaangom. The continentality subtype is hypercontinental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1657.8 mm (65.3 in) less which is equivalent to 1657.8 l/m² (40.69 US gal/ft²) or 16,578,000 l/ha (1,772,298 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 20.8° lower in Ulaangom than in Passo Fundo.
